Renee O'Connor (1971 - )
Film Deaths[]
- Night Game (1989) [Lorraine Beasley]: Throat slashed with a prosthetic hook by Rex Linn while she's toying with Dee Hennigan in a hall of mirrors.
- Boogeyman 2 (2007) [Dr. Jessica Ryan]: Decapitated with garden shears by Danielle Savre, after Matthew Cohen had placed his mask on the near-catatonic Renee so that Danielle would mistake her for him; her identity is revealed when the mask is taken off of the severed head.
- Ghost Town: The Movie (2007) [Little Jack]: Used as a human shield by Harmon Teaster during a street shoot-out after being previously injured.
Television Deaths[]
- Xena, Warrior Princess: Been There, Done That (1997) [Gabrielle]: While caught in a time loop, she dies twice (but always returns when the day restarts in the morning): (1) Stabbed to death in a swordfight with some villagers. (2) Shot (along with Lucy Lawless and Ted Raimi) with a barrage of arrows after Ted insults both feuding families in an attempt to unite them.
- Xena, Warrior Princess: Sacrifice, Part II (1998) [Gabrielle/Hope]: Playing a dual role as both "Gabrielle" and her supernaturally-conceived daughter "Hope," they both fell into the lava pit after "Gabrielle" sacrificed herself by dragging "Hope" with her to prevent Lucy Lawless from killing "Hope" that would've resulted in Lucy's death by the Fates. (Gabrielle was revealed to have been saved by Kevin Smith in Soul Possessions.)
- Xena, Warrior Princess: A Family Affair (1998) [Gabrielle/Hope]: Playing a dual role as both "Gabrielle" and her supernaturally-conceived daughter "Hope," "Hope" is stabbed by her own offspring (Mark Viniello) with its poisoned spikes.
- Hercules The Legendary Journeys: Armageddon Now Part II (1998) [Gabrielle]: Executed by being crucified after having her legs broken.
- Xena, Warrior Princess: The Ides of March (1999) [Gabrielle]: Crucified, along with Lucy Lawless, on the orders of Karl Urban. (They were brought back to life by Charles Mesure's heavenly powers in the next season's opening episode Fallen Angel.)
